Warning Signs You Need Wet Vacuum Water Extraction

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s, safety hazards, and even health risks. Our team is here to help you identify the signs and take action before it’s too late.

Standing Water That Won’t Drain

If you notice water pooling in your home, especially in areas like the kitchen or bathroom, it’s a sign that you need Wet Vacuum Water Extraction.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ore musty smells in your home, they can be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th, which can lead to serious health issues.

Warped or Discolored Floors and Walls

If you notice warping, discoloration, or other damage to your floors and walls, it’s a sign that you need Wet Vacuum Water Extraction to prevent further dam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Don’t ignore peeling paint or wallpaper, it can be a sign of moisture damage that needs to be addressed ASAP.

Visible Water Stains or Damage

If you notice water stains or damage to your ceilings, walls, or floors, it’s a sign that you need Wet Vacuum Water Extraction to prevent further issues.

Increased Humidity or Moisture Levels

If you notice a sudden increase in humidity or moisture levels in your home, it’s a sign that you need Wet Vacuum Water Extraction to prevent mold and bacteria growth.

Wet Vacuum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ill, contained within a small area Yes No You can handle a small spill with a wet vacuum and some elbow grease.
Large water damage, multiple rooms affected No Yes A large water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Hidden water damage, not immediately visible No Yes Hidden water damage can lead to serious issues like mold and bacteria growth, call a pro to ensure it’s properly addressed.
Water damage in a crawl space or hard-to-reach area No Yes Water damage in hard-to-reach areas need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Water damage in a sensitive area, like a kitchen or bathroom No Yes Sensitive areas need specialized care to prevent further damage and ensure safety, call a pro to get it right.
Water damage in a large commercial space No Yes Large commercial spaces need spec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ure safety, call a pro to get it done right.

Wet Vacuum Water Extraction Cost in Justin, TX

The cost of Wet Vacuum Water Extraction in Justin, TX,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free, no-obligation estimate after assessing the damage and developing a customized plan to tackle the problem.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ed to extract the water.
Drying and Monitoring the Space $300 – $1,500 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ed to dry the space.
Equipment Rental and Labor $200 – $1,000 The type of equipment needed to extract the water and dry the space.
Specialized Equipment and Labor $500 – $2,500 The type of equipment needed to tackle specific challenges, like hidden water damage or sensitive areas.
More Repairs and Maintenance N/A Depending on the extent of the damage, more repairs and maintenance may be required to ensure your home is safe and secure.

Keep in mind that these estimates are subject to change based on the specifics of your situation. Our team will provide a customized quote after assessing the damage and developing a plan to tackle the problem.
